The Critical Role of Thermal Management in Power Electronics
Let’s face it: in power electronics, heat is the silent saboteur. Whether you’re designing in Helsinki or Houston, thermal management isn’t just a box to tick - it’s the difference between a product that dazzles and one that fizzles.
This article dives into the real-world problems of power electronics cooling, with a special focus on what happens when things get too hot to handle. Spoiler alert: overheating causes a whopping 55% of all electronics failures. That’s not just a statistic - it’s a wake-up call for power electronics designers. Should you pay more attention to it?

The Solution? Lower Temperature, Higher Performance with NEOcore Technology
At CooliBlade, we know power electronics cooling inside and out. Our NEOcore technology isn’t just another heat sink - it’s a game-changer.
NEOcore is a groundbreaking advancement in heat dissipation that leverages an innovative design and extraordinary thermal conductivity. NEOcore’s revolutionary design is particularly beneficial for cooling IGBT (Insulated Gate Bipolar Transistors) and SiC (Silicon Carbide) power modules, where efficient heat management is critical.
